Did you get this resolved? if not here is one more thing that could help.
I'll tell you step by step to see if it helps.
1. go to download page.
2. download a preset.
3. it should be saved to your desktop unless you have a different location where you save it.
4. Open the file it should be in a winrar file. When you click on the file the icon looks like books.
5. highlight what you need and then click extract to desktop.
6.open the HID boot loader.
7. connect the controller.
8. click open hex file.
9. open the preset you want.
10. click program/verify.
11. reset the device and go play.
